Tires Easy

   

Tires Are Easy To Steer Both On and Off Road

If you own a truck or drive one, you would know how important good tires are, especially for off road conditions. They are the difference between getting stuck or passing and pulling through no matter how rugged the terrains are. This is why those who are currently planning to buy tires should know that they should get tires easy to steer but tough on off road conditions.

Off road mud, for instance, poses a big challenge to riders and they should be on the lookout for truck mud tires. There is a wide array of 4x4 off road tires in the market, the choices, however, can be overwhelming. It is a must that you know clearly what kind of tires you need and how much you can afford. These details will help you get started with your selection.

Most truck mud tires, aside from being able to perform well in off road mud, also behave decently in other rough conditions such as the snow, rocky surfaces and other rugged terrain. For this reason, it is good to get such kind of tires to serve different needs.

One of the best choices you have is the BF Goodrich Mud Terrain T/A which is the only tire recognized in the JP magazine (enthusiast publication) as part of the top 10 all-time-off-road products. It has superb traction for deep dirt, mud and rocks because of the DiggerLugz feature which involves upper sidewall traction bars and tread clearing shoulder void bars. It also has incredible rock climbing and slick surface traction and it shows improved wheel and tire protection from off-road hazards. The price starts at $150.

For choice of a mud king tire, the BF Goodrich Mud King XT tire is worth considering. It is a light truck tire with aggressive design.

Another good option is the Maxxis Buckshot mud tire which has a staggered shoulders, deep lugs and high voids offering ultimate traction in off road conditions. These tires are also puncture resistant with its extra strong double casing that enhances durability; plus the advanced rubber compound with tread siping provides maximum control in various weather conditions. They are sold for around $140 for the 235x75R-15 4 ply with bigger sizes having higher cost. This tire brand is excellent even in soupy mud and self clean efficiently. It also performs well in snow, wet or powder conditions. Even on the street, it gives off just minimal to moderate noise, which is better than the other truck mud tires.

 

For a choice of a mud king tire, there is the New Medalist Mud King XT which is sold for $500 for a set of 4 tires. It is a light off road truck tire with open aggressive tread pattern perfect for off road surfaces.

If you are on a budget and are looking for cheap off road tires, there are online stores dealing with used but good quality 4x4 off road tires. They carry all major brands of used tires such as Goodyear. These used tires are subjected to quality assurance tests before they are made available for sale.

Tip of the day:

If you get stuck in the mud, don't continue to spin the wheels in hopes of getting unstuck. Find rocks or gravel and put it near the wheel and try to rock the car out by pressing gently on the gas, then releasing.
